With regards to your onboard network interface, is it a Broadcom 4400
chipset? If so, there are experimental drivers in Linux 2.6 (which work
well, but without magic packet support for WOL) otherwise there are
'official' Broadcom Linux drivers (opensource) here - I'm not sure where
the official website for them is however.

http://www.softlab.ntua.gr/~amanous/Inspiron-Linux/files/bcm4400-2.0.5.tar.gz

There's also this:

http://packages.debian.org/testing/net/bcm4400-source

And I think there are is also b44.c or something in Linux 2.4 but I've
never used that one. It was the basis for the 2.6 driver I think.
